Posted on 11/28/18 at 3:30 pm to CivilTiger83
quote:
Come on man... yall were once stacked with NFL talent in the early 2000s with CHAN DULLDRUMS GAILEY. Stop with the loser mentality.
Go get yourself Neal Brown from Troy, and start recruiting like you are capable of recruiting
LMAO and that is why the academic side tightened down. O'leary was allowed to take some kids that we won't take now. We were put on probation for playing ineligible players in 2003. Call it what you will, but we can't compete with the likes of Clemson, Alabama, and Georgia for athletes. Every once in a while we can land a Calvin Johnson, but those types of kids are few and far between. We are trying to boost funding for our athletics program now, but the rest of major college football has left us in the dust. Our current AD is making up ground from our last horrible AD.
I would love a Neal Brown hire. We need something to differentiate us, and that offense could be a lot of fun.
